Small Pixel Pitch LED Display Modules vs. Cabinets: Which Is Better?
When people choose small-pixel LED displays, they can be divided into two options: LED modules and LED cabinets. Some customers may not know the difference between the module and cabinet structures of LED displays. Which one is better? Generally speaking, in terms of the overall display effect and the convenience of installation and disassembly, the LED display cabinet is better than the LED module due to the LED cabinet has better flatness, which brings the overall effect of splicing and the integrated display effect of the picture are better.
At the same time, the installation of the cabinet is faster than that of the LED module, because the cabinet is larger in size and easier to disassemble, and will not collide with each other to cause lamp beads. Hence, it is more conducive to the stability of long-term use.

What is an LED module of LED display?
LED display Module is the basic unit that makes up an LED display. A complete LED display is formed by splicing multiple LED modules. Different pixel-pitch LED lamp beads are distributed on the modules. Many modules are spliced together to assemble some large LED displays. For example, indoor P2, P2.5, P3, P4, P5 and other specifications are also mostly made of LED modules.

What is an LED display cabinet?
The LED display cabinet is composed of several LED display modules that can be combined and spliced. To meet different environments, coupled with a set of appropriate controllers (main control boards or control systems), display boards (or unit boxes) of various specifications,it can form many kinds of LED displays.

Introduce the LED screen Cabinet IP level
From the above we know that LED screens can be used in different locations and require different types of cabinets, and LED cabinets need strong performance and protection to protect them from external damage. In order to assess the protection performance of LED screens, an IP rating system has been introduced.
The IP (Ingress Protection) rating comprises two digits:
- The first digit signifies the level of protection against solid objects or materials.
- The second digit indicates the level of protection against liquids.
For instance, an IP rating of 54 indicates a level 5 protection against solid objects and a level 4 protection against liquids. An “X” in place of either digit (e.g., IPX1) signifies that the product is rated for protection against one type of ingress but not the other.

LED cabinet maintenance is critical to the longevity of your LED screen, and you can choose to access it from the front or the back.
- While Front-access LED modules more complex and costly, it can be mounted close to the wall on slender frames.
- In contrast, rear back LED screens are often mounted on back with enough space.
Currently, the small pixel LED displays cabinet are basically below P2, such as P1.86, P1.53, P1.25, and P0.9 etc, especially for COB packaged LED displays.

The differences between LED display modules and cabinets;
The main differences between LED display modules and cabinets are size, pixel pitch, flatness after installation and price.
Size difference
Usually, the size of the LED module is relatively small. The current mainstream LED display modules are 160mm*160mm, 320mm*320mm, etc., while the size of the LED cabinet is relatively large, such as the mainstream small-pitch LED display cabinets are 480mm*480mm, 600mm*337.5mm, etc. The latter size is more popular with customers because the ratio of this size is designed to be 16:9, making it easier to maintain the conventional display ratio of the entire LED display.
The difference between pixel pitch
Most of the LED displays composed of LED modules have large pixel pitches that are basically between P2~P20, while the LED display cabinets are mostly used in indoor small-pitch LED displays, mainly used for below P2.
Difference in flatness
Since the size of the cabinet is larger, when it is installed into a large-size LED display, the flatness of the LED display spliced out of the cabinet is better, while the seams and concavity of the LED module splicing are often difficult to control. , which will directly affect the later display effect.
The difference in convenience between installation and disassembly
The board size of the LED module is relatively small, so the installation is slow and requires splicing piece by piece. The large size of the cabinet makes it more convenient to install, and it is also more convenient to disassemble and repair later.
Price difference
In the composition of some small-pitch LED displays, you can choose to use cabinets or modules. For example, P2, P1.8, P1.5, etc. can also use modules, and choose to use modules. The price of the LED module will be cheaper than the LED cabinet. For some occasions with limited budget, the module will be more cost-effective.

Conclusion:
The LED display cabinet has been gradually applied to the market in recent years. It is mainly used in the composition of small-pitch LED displays, especially P1.8, P1.5, P1.25, P0.9, etc. It is more convenient to install and disassemble, and has better flatness. While the price of modules is relatively low but not to easy install. When designing, the choice of whether to use an LED display cabinet or a module mainly depends on the LED display pixel pitch and other factors such as whether it is frequently disassembled and the budget.

What is a LED display system?
Typically, an LED display is referred to as a screen display technology. This technology uses panels of LEDs as the main source of light. Electronic devices regardless of big and small are using LED display technology. These are used for interaction between the users and the display systems.
For commercial use, an LED display system constitutes the main screen display that you find around displaying advertisements everywhere. LED displays are known for their low power consumption and efficiency. In a massive LED display, you can find plenty of LED panels that consist of several LEDs.
Apart from using low energy, LED displays come with greater light intensity. Additionally, they have amazing brilliance as well. This is the reason why they are used in public places as commercial products.
Components of a LED display system
Led display systems have two important parts: An LED panel and a controller. The primary LED panel comes with multiple display units of LEDs, referred to as LED panels or LED cabinets. They are connected and constitute the main body of the LED display system.
So, that was everything about the LED panel. Speaking about the controller, it can be segregated into two parts. The controller includes the control board that represents the hardware and the control system that represents the software. A small computer, a receiving card, and a sending card are the components that you will find on the control board.
A wide range of cabinet units or display panels with separate controllers and specifications can become a part of the LED displays. They come with different control technologies and fulfill the demands of different types of applications in various environments. Some examples could include multifunction cards and video processors.
Comparison of LED display systems to traditional displays
When it comes to comparison between traditional displays and LED display systems, the main difference is in the backlights. While traditional displays use fluorescent backlights, LED displays use light-emitting diodes in place of backlights. As such, LEDs will have a better picture quality and be available in varying configurations.
Traditional displays give mediocre to poor visual performance when not viewed within the right viewing angles. The image produced on the display will consist of blurry lines, unsettling brightness, and poor contrast. Although LED displays have fewer viewing angles compared to traditional displays, LEDs influence the image quality to a great extent.
The power used by traditional displays and LEDs will depend on certain factors such as the brightness of the display, build quality, screen size, resolution, power-saver settings, etc. There is no denying that bigger displays with large resolutions will consume more power. Still, LED displays are more efficient than the traditional displays.
Benefits of using LED display systems
Below listed are the benefits of using LED display systems.
LED systems use high-end technology that not only gives performance but also is extremely reliable. These systems that are designed for digital billboards have changed the way things were a few years ago.
These display systems are lightweight and provide realistic, high-quality images.
Low energy consumption is what makes these systems amazing. They are eco-friendly options and help businesses reduce costs.
There is no limit to the size of LED display systems when it comes to installation. In terms of delivering advertisement messages, they can display as big as you want them to be.
An LED display system will have a prolonged lifespan compared to traditional systems.
